When The B-52’s emerged from Athens, Georgia, in 1979, they didn't just join the New Wave movement; they threw a neon-colored party in the middle of it. "Rock Lobster" is the centerpiece of that celebration—a 6-minute odyssey of Farfisa organs, MOSRITE guitar riffs, and lyrics that sound like a fever dream at a 1950s beach party.

The song famously features a breakdown of increasingly bizarre animal impressions—from narwhals to "bikini whales."
